Player who tackled female referee from behind banned in Italy

An Argentinian rugby player who inexplicably tackled a female referee from behind during an Italian league game has been banned for three years, the Italian rugby federation (FIR) announced on Thursday.

Bruno Andres Doglioli, captain of Serie A side Rangers Rugby Vicenza, violently tackled referee Maria Beatrice Benvenuti in an off-the-ball incident which left the 23-year-old official with whiplash.
